[12:01:41] <wjp> Colourless: as far as I can tell, the only remaining build problem on linux is now in ALSAMidiDriver; specifically, it uses perr.printf and SettingManager
[12:02:03] <wjp> I assume you want to keep the copies of those files identical in pentagram and exult CVS?
[12:03:32] <wjp> the perr.printf can just be converted to a perr <<, of course, but the SettingManager use will most likely need some #ifdef
[12:04:44] <wjp> hm, UnixSeqMidiDriver uses SettingManager too, I see; that must not've been built for me
[12:05:16] <wjp> could maybe add a protected method to MidiDriver that accesses a config string
[12:05:26] <wjp> and keep the #ifdef limited to that
[12:31:58] <Colourless> look in the WindowsMidiDriver file
[12:32:24] <Colourless> i've got #ifdefs and use config in exult with an appropriate key
[12:32:51] <Colourless> but yes, that might be a good idea.
[12:36:32] <Colourless> (being config reading option in MidiDriver)
[12:45:03] <Colourless> i could also just make a SettingManager wrapper (like i did for FileSystem)
[12:56:58] <wjp> one which would automatically look in the config/audio/midi subtree?
[12:58:07] <Colourless> probably better then if it was in MidiDriver to automatically choose the correct subtree
[12:58:52] <Colourless> might also want to edit Timidity to specify the config file path from the TimidityMidiDriver.cpp file instead of timidity.cpp i think
[12:59:31] <wjp> yeah, true
